A group which is comprised
of members of all parties represented in the Parliament of the United Kingdom
of Great Britain is staying in Ukraine targeting to form an objective vision
about the state of matters in the country, the process of intrdocuing
reforms and the situation joined with aggression by Russia, and also to discuss
what assistance for the Government of Ukraine and the people of Ukraine must be
provided by the European countries and, notably of Great Britain, to be
effective.

in them. According to Volodymyr Hroysman,
a lot of people in the eastern region have no chance yet to consciously
evaluate the benefits of the local self-government reform – an opportunity to
manage the territories they live in, have a certain financial resource from
local and a part of national taxes for the development of those territories,
elect and control the local authorities, and as a result to improve their
wealth. The attempts to destabilize the eastern regions are taken, notably, to
hamper a dialog between the Government and the residents about the prospects
how to develop the country.
“The first step is
cessation of the aggression. When we stop, the communication window with the
residents of the eastern regions will enlarge,” the Vice Prime Minister
stressed.
